So, 'The Beerhouse' from 2009 is this intriguing piece where Noynoy dives into the depths of the underground scene, all for the sake of liberating Ningning. The tone has this gritty edge, almost like you're following someone who’s in way over their head, which I appreciate. The atmosphere feels raw and unrefined, capturing that shady underbelly vibe. Performances are quite engaging, and there’s a palpable tension that runs throughout the film. It's not just another run-of-the-mill storyline; it explores themes of loyalty and sacrifice in a way that feels personal. The pacing keeps you on your toes, and you can feel the weight of each decision made by the characters. Not the typical fare, but that’s what makes it stand out.
'The Beerhouse' remains somewhat elusive in collector circles, which adds to its charm. Formats are limited, making original copies a bit of a rarity. There’s a certain niche interest around it, especially among those who appreciate films that delve into the darker themes of life. Its scarcity and unique underground narrative make it a curious piece for any collector looking to expand their library with something a bit off the beaten path.
